Lavrov: No country should live the fate of Libya

Russia is not interested in maintaining its military presence in the Middle East by creating conflicts between different countries.

Axar.az reports that the statement came from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ov.

"We are interested in developing trade, economic, investment and other relations with countries that serve mutual interests. We do not want any country in the region to suffer the fate of Libya. Libya has been deprived of its statehood and they still do not know how to unite the pieces," Lavrov said.
